  • Publication number: 20240054767
    Abstract: Provided are a multi-modal model training method, apparatus and device, and a storage medium. The method includes the following steps: obtaining a training sample set, and training a multi-modal model for a plurality of rounds by successively using each of training sample pair in the training sample set: during use of any one of the training sample pairs for training, obtaining an image feature of a target visual sample firstly, and then determining whether back translation needs to be performed on a target original text; when back translation needs to be performed on the target original text, performing corresponding back translation to obtain a target back-translated text, and obtaining a text feature of the target back-translated text; and training the multi-modal model based on the image feature and the text feature.

  • Patent number: 11810388
    Abstract: The present application discloses a person re-identification method and apparatus based on a deep learning network, a device, and a medium. The method includes: obtaining an initial person re-identification network; creating a homogeneous training network corresponding to the initial person re-identification network, where the homogeneous training network comprises a plurality of homogeneous branches with a same network structure; training the homogeneous training network by using a target loss function, and determining a final weight parameter of each network layer in the homogeneous training network; and loading the final weight parameter by using the initial person re-identification network to obtain a final person re-identification network, to perform a person re-identification task by using the final person re-identification network.

  • Publication number: 20230316722
    Abstract: The present application discloses an image recognition method and apparatus, and a device and a readable storage medium. The method includes: obtaining a target image to be recognized; inputting the target image into a trained feature extraction model for feature extraction to obtain image features; and using the image features to recognize the target image to obtain a recognition result. In the present application, under the condition that the parameter quantity and the calculation amount of the feature extraction model do not need to be increased, the feature extraction model has relatively good feature extraction performance by means of isomorphic branch extraction and feature mutual mining, namely knowledge collaboration assistive training, and more accurate image recognition may be completed on the basis of the image features extracted by the feature extraction model.

  • Publication number: 20220343166
    Abstract: A computing method and apparatus for a convolutional neural network model. The method comprises: acquiring a computing model of a training task of a convolutional neural network model (S101); then splitting multiply-accumulate operation in a computing model of a training task of the convolutional neural network model into a plurality of multiply-add operation tasks (S102); confirming a computing device corresponding to each multiply-add operation task according to the correlation between a preset computing model and the computing device (S103); and finally, respectively computing each multiply-add operation task by utilizing the computing device corresponding to each multiply-add operation task (S104). The purposes of improving the flexibility of migration of a CNN model training task on different computing devices or cooperative computing of different processors and improving the computing speed are achieved.
